Summary
Hugo Kendal and his wife, Margaret, finally receive a royal pardon and are permitted at last to return to their beloved homeland. Most of the family warmly welcome the couple and the news that they are soon to become three.
However, despite the smiles, Hannah Kendal cannot help but dwell on the threat that Hugo might pose to her husband Simon's position as Master of Heron. She is not alone; Luke, the father of Simon, is acutely aware that Hugo, as his elder brother's son, could declare a more legitimate claim.
To complicate matters further, Maria Lessor, a headstrong 12-year-old verging on womanhood, nurtures a secret love for Hugo and seems willing to stop at nothing to claim him as hers.
